Waterfront views and central location in Savannah historic district
Stay at Holiday Inn Express, located in the heart of the historic district and soak up the old-world splendor of Savannah. The contemporary, southern-style property sits on Bay Street just steps from the waterfront and surrounded by Savannah's lush squares, historic houses, boutiques and fine restaurants along lively Broughton and River Streets. The hotel features a graceful lobby with a full-service fireside lounge, a rooftop pool, well-equipped guest rooms with high-speed Internet access and 2,000 square feet of meeting space.

Rooms
Diverse room choices include guestrooms with one queen, king or two queen beds. Deluxe rooms offer one queen or king bed, plus wet bar, sitting area and pullout sofa bed. All rooms include a refrigerator, microwave, iron with ironing board, coffee maker, flat-screen TV, work desk and Wi-Fi access (free).
Features
Guests can easily walk to many of downtown Savannah's most popular attractions thanks to the hotel's central location overlooking the waterfront. Cross the street from the hotel to the trolley stop and join a trolley tour of Savannah's historic sites. Inside the hotel, guests can relax by the fireplace with a cocktail from the lobby bar, take a dip in the rooftop pool or exercise in the on-site fitness center. The hotel serves complimentary breakfast and offers free Wi-Fi access throughout the property. Guests will find computers at the business center and flexible meeting rooms totaling 2,000 square feet accommodates up to 50 people. Meeting space includes the 1,365-square-foot Magnolia Room, the 950-square-foot Azalea Room and the Live Oak boardroom, which seats 12.

Roaming from Frederick
Love the location, but . . .
So, the location is right in Savannah's historic district about a 5 minute walk from the river. Our room was comfortable, but you could hear every noise in the hallway and out in the street. If you are hoping to get a good night's sleep, maybe not the best place. We were also disappointed in the staff. When we checked in, the staff was very accommodating and friendly, but Sunday morning when we left, we didn't even get a "good morning" or "how was your room". Just seemed interested in processing us out and moving on to the next person. Next trip to Savannah we will probably look for a different hotel.

Aimless Travelers
Surprisingly good
this was by far the coolest HI Express I've ever stayed in. Normally, I associated these with interstate exits and barely-standing walls. This is a refurbished building in the heart of the historic district, directly across from the old cotton exchange with its shops and restaurants. There are two significant points of concern, each of which other reviewers previously commented negatively on as well. First, the lifts are SLOW and inefficient for moving people up and down. Second, valet parking took FOREVER. they were averaging 10 minutes per car and could evidently only retrieve 1 car at a time. Park yourself!
